launchctl submit kept reopening an app after every quit
2
Upvotes
A local macOS app came back as soon as I quit it. The binary was not the cause.
Two leftover jobs from earlier repair sessions were still registered with launchd. Both had been created with `launchctl submit`. Apple's man page says that also tells launchd to keep the program alive in the event of failure.
Recorded run counts: 8,429 and 9,169. After both labels were unloaded, the same quit left the app absent for twenty seconds of half-second samples. The app source was not changed.
launchctl print gui/$(id -u)/<label>
Print the job before you rewrite the app.
